> > $ cat x11/kde-applications/k3b/pkg/DESCR
> > K3b was created to be a feature-rich and easy to handle CD burning
> > application.  It can do many things, such as creating or copying audio,
> > data, video or mixed-mode CDs, CD ripping, and DVD ripping, burning and
> > blanking.
